Born in 1999, a race car driver from Britain started karting at a young age and progressed through various racing series. In 2019, debuted in Formula 1 with McLaren. Achieved multiple top-ten finishes and earned recognition for competitive performances. Continued to develop as a driver and build a strong rapport with the team and fans during subsequent seasons.
Debuted in Formula 1 with McLaren in 2019
Achieved multiple top-ten finishes in races
Secured a podium finish in the 2021 Italian Grand Prix
